It's just a RTS, with a WWII aspect.

It's really good in the RTS family, it has most of the gameplay of the previous RTS released by the same editor (Dawn of War serie), adding breathtaking graphics.

People who like RTS should really try this one, because it's one of the best on the market.

But still, it's a RTS, it lacks any kind of realism and is far from being a simulation (although they added some interesting features,like tanks have better armor in front than behind)

I got Company of Heroes. I like several features it has that other RTS dont have.

For instance, each soldier in the squad thinks individually. They will spread out to find cover behind walls, wrecks, rubble, slopes, and the like. Pretty intelligent. When you have a squad occupy a building, they dont just all stay on one side of the house. They spread out, covering all approaches. If the house has been damaged, then some of them will take cover in the holes or rubble. When attacking a house, nothing beats watching it take more damage from grenades and other weapons. If a house takes enough damage, from big enough weapons, it will become completely destroyed and even block roads, which adds another element to the game. Infantry squads can also be equipped with Sticky Bombs.

Vehicles can take all sorts of damage. The gunner can be killed, disabling the gun. Engines can be damaged, causing the vehicle to run out of control and crash into something, causing it to blow up and send bodies flying. All sorts of things like that. The game seems to combine elemets from games like Combat Mission (where such things occur in the turn-based combat) with RTS games.

I also like how vehicles can be upgraded. I like how that one tank can have the spinning contraption on the end of it to blow up mines safely, yet also be used to chop up any unfortuneate infantry that get too close.

And the enviroments are totally destructable. And for supplies, you have to capture little zones and make sure they connect all the way back to your base. Which adds a new thing to combat - cutting off the supply line.
